VCU Technology Services (VCUTS) has received feedback concerning network performance via the VCUTS Help Desk, email, and other communication channels.  Keith Deane, Associate Director for Network Services provides the following update:

VCUTS Network Services is aware that the VCU data network is currently experiencing intermittent performance issues with both internal (VCU only) and external (Internet) traffic. We have been working with our equipment vendors over the last two weeks to determine the cause of these problems. To date, we have made configuration changes that have positively impacted some services but issues remain. Network Services is aggressively working with our vendors to determine the cause of these issues and develop the appropriate solutions.
